· Auto-generated from filings + methodologyKasa Uzajamne Pomoći Radnika Komunalca Bjelovar is a registered human services nonprofit based in Ferde Livadića 14a, Bjelovar, Croatia. It is registered with the Croatian Register of Associations. It was founded in 2004 and has been operating for 22 years. Its registration number is 58010397628. It has a GiveRadar Integrity Assessment of 52/100 (Partial transparency), indicating some public data is available but key signals are missing. This is above the average of 49/100 for human services charities in Croatia.

KASA UZAJAMNE POMOĆI RADNIKA KOMUNALCA BJELOVAR is in Croatia (EU/EEA). Dutch donors may be eligible for deductibility if the charity is recognized under the Dutch ANBI cross-EU equivalence rules. Check the Belastingdienst ANBI register or consult a Dutch tax advisor.
KASA UZAJAMNE POMOĆI RADNIKA KOMUNALCA BJELOVAR is registered in Croatia. US donors generally cannot deduct gifts to non-US charities directly. To claim a deduction, route the gift through a US 'Friends of' fiscal sponsor or a donor-advised fund that performs equivalency determination (IRS Rev. Proc. 92-94).
Always confirm tax treatment with the charity directly or your tax advisor before donating.
